Windows版JDK11压缩包解压安装方法详解

需积分: 0 35 下载量 49 浏览量 更新于2024-11-10 收藏 184.29MB ZIP 举报
资源摘要信息:"JDK11 windows zip 解压缩版" 知识点详细说明: 1. JDK的含义及版本号 - JDK(Java Development Kit)是甲骨文公司提供的Java开发工具包,包含用于Java应用程序开发的编译器、运行时环境和核心库。版本号11指的是JDK的一个特定版本,该版本包含了一系列的新特性和改进。 2. JDK11的重要更新 - JDK 11版本中,Oracle引入了多项改进和新特性,例如对HTTP/2的支持、新的HTTP客户端API、对JEP 321(Epsilon: A No-Op Garbage Collector)的支持、局部变量类型推断(Local-Variable Type Inference)的改进等。 - 该版本还引入了对旧版本JDK中已经移除的旧特性(如Java EE和CORBA模块)的废弃,以及对实验性质API的标记。 3. JDK11 Windows版本的特性 - JDK11的Windows版本为开发者提供了一个Windows平台上的Java开发环境,使其能够在Windows操作系统上编译、运行和调试Java程序。 - 此版本的JDK与之前版本相比,在性能上有所提升,安全性得到了加强,并且针对多核处理器进行了优化。 4. Zip解压缩版的概念 - Zip解压缩版指的是JDK安装文件以zip格式提供,不需要安装即可直接解压缩使用。 - 与传统的安装程序相比,Zip版本不需要复杂的安装步骤,直接下载解压即可使用,非常适合快速部署或者不需要全局安装的场景。 5. Windows平台下JDK的配置 - 在Windows平台上安装JDK11,首先需要下载对应的zip文件,并将其解压到指定目录。 - 解压后,需要配置系统的环境变量,如JAVA_HOME变量,以指向JDK的安装目录。 - 配置完毕后,需要将JDK的bin目录添加到PATH环境变量中,以便在命令行中能够使用java和javac等命令。 6. 如何使用JDK11 Windows Zip解压缩版进行开发 - 开发者可以使用命令行工具来编译和运行Java程序。 - 对于集成开发环境(IDE)的支持,虽然IDE通常需要安装,但可以在IDE中配置外部JDK路径指向解压缩版JDK的位置。 7. 使用场景 - Zip解压缩版的JDK适合于需要快速切换不同版本JDK的场景,以及对于环境隔离有特殊要求的开发环境。 - 此外,它也适合学习、测试和小型项目,因为它不需要复杂的安装过程,可以很方便地进行版本控制。 8. 兼容性问题 - 在使用JDK11的Zip解压缩版时,需要确保依赖的第三方库和开发工具兼容Java 11的API和运行时特性。 - 如果有不兼容的情况,可能需要寻找替代的库或工具,或者使用传统的安装版JDK。 9. 安全性考虑 - 由于JDK是运行Java程序的基础环境,因此安全性极为重要。在使用JDK11 Windows Zip解压缩版时,需要确保来源可靠,防止潜在的安全风险。 10. 维护与更新 - 当JDK11有了新的更新或补丁时,开发者需要手动下载新的zip文件并替换旧版本。 - 如果需要升级,也应确保新版本与现有项目兼容,避免因升级引起的应用程序运行问题。 通过上述知识点的详细说明,可以全面了解JDK11 windows zip解压缩版的特点和使用方法,帮助开发者在Windows平台上更好地使用Java进行开发。